Mean
The mean, often referred to as the average, is a statistic that represents the central or typical value in a set of data, calculated by dividing the sum of all values by the number of values.
Population Standard Error
A measure that estimates the variability of sample means around the population mean if multiple samples were taken from the population.
Confidence Interval
A band of values, yielded by analyzing sample data, which has a good chance of capturing the value of an unknown population variable.
